Skip to content

Commit e930a92

Browse files
authored
Fixed PipelineStatus.Created handling (#64)
1 parent 2a62b06 commit e930a92

File tree

1 file changed

+5
-2
lines changed

1 file changed

+5
-2
lines changed

src/MergeRequestAcceptor.ts

Lines changed: 5 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-118,7 +118,6 @@ export enum BotLabels {
118118
const startingOrInProgressPipelineStatuses = [
119119
PipelineStatus.Running,
120120
PipelineStatus.Pending,
121-
PipelineStatus.Created,
122121
PipelineStatus.WaitingForResource,
123122
PipelineStatus.Preparing,
124123
];
@@ -328,7 +327,11 @@ export const acceptMergeRequest = async (gitlabApi: GitlabApi, mergeRequest: Mer
328327
};
329328
}
330329

331-
if (currentPipeline.status !== PipelineStatus.Success && currentPipeline.status !== PipelineStatus.Skipped) {
330+
if (
331+
currentPipeline.status !== PipelineStatus.Success
332+
&& currentPipeline.status !== PipelineStatus.Skipped
333+
&& currentPipeline.status !== PipelineStatus.Created
334+
) {
332335
throw new Error(`Unexpected pipeline status: ${currentPipeline.status}`);
333336
}
334337
}

0 commit comments

Comments
 (0)